Q1:

N.T.P. corresponds to

A 1 atm.absolute pressure& 0°C.

B 760 mm Hg gauge pressure & 0°C.

C 760 torr & 15°C.

D 101.325 KPa gauge pressure & 0°C.

ANS:A - 1 atm.absolute pressure& 0°C.

N.T.P. stands for "Normal Temperature and Pressure." It corresponds to standard conditions used for measuring and comparing the properties of gases. The standard conditions for N.T.P. are: 1 atm absolute pressure (equivalent to 101.325 kPa), 0°C temperature (equivalent to 273.15 Kelvin or 32°F), and These conditions are chosen for convenience and standardization in scientific and engineering applications. Therefore, among the given options, the one that corresponds to N.T.P. is: 1 atm absolute pressure & 0°C.
